Abstract: Tuberculosis (TB) is a potentially fatal contagious disease that can affect almost any part of the body but is mainly an infection of the lungs. It is caused by a bacterial microorganism, the tubercle bacillus or Mycobacterium tuberculosis. TB can be treated, cured, and can be prevented if persons at risk take certain drugs. This study concerned mainly in finding an alternative material to phenol used in traditional Ziehl Neelsen stain for staining acid fast bacilli and excluding it is highly toxicity from the staining solution hence developing safer staining method. Certain selective lipophilic agents, liquid organic detergents,clorax,fairy and alfa were used. Archival Paraffin blocks that suggestive of TB Infection upon diagnosis were reviewed , sectioned and stained . By these methods acid fast bacilli were detected and stained red in blue background. Result obtained compared very favourably with traditional Ziehl Neelsen stain. In addition Detergents are efficient lipophilic agents and safer to handle than phenol. In brief, the methods described here stains acid fast bacilli as efficiently as traditional carbol fuchsin method. Liquid organic cleaners are considerably cheaper.
